Position Overview
The Staff Operational Technology (OT) Manufacturing Engineer is responsible for designing, implementing, validating, and supporting operational technology solutions that enable safe, compliant, and efficient manufacturing operations. This role focuses on industrial control systems, automation, OT–IT integration, and lifecycle support of PLC/SCADA/DCS systems and MES interfaces for on‑market products. The Staff OT Engineer partners with R&D, Quality, Production, IT, and Supply Chain to ensure robust control systems, validated processes, and secure, reliable production operations.
EssentialJob Functions
- Design, develop, program, and deploy industrial control systems (PLCs, PACs), HMI/SCADA applications, and control logic to support manufacturing processes.
- Lead OT for process/tool/fixture implementations: define functional/user requirements and system specifications, manage vendor deliverables, and provide on‑site commissioning, ramp support, and operator/maintainer training.
- Plan and execute system validation activities (IQ/OQ/PQ) for control systems, sequencing logic, and MES/SCADA integrations; ensure documentation meets regulatory requirements.
- Integrate OT systems with MES/ERP/PLM systems (data handshakes, batch records, recipe management), support data migration and ensure electronic records integrity.
- Implement and maintain secure, segmented OT networks with IT/cybersecurity; lead OT cyber risk management (vulnerabilities, patching/compensating controls, access controls, incident response) aligned to IEC 62443 and NIST.
- Troubleshoot production control issues, perform root cause analysis (DMAIC), and implement corrective actions to restore and improve process stability and throughput.
- Develop and maintain control system documentation: control logic descriptions, wiring diagrams, I/O lists, HMI screen specs, SOPs, and validation records.
- Lead or participate in pFMEA and risk assessments focused on control and automation risks; translate risk findings into mitigation actions and design changes.
- Conduct capability studies and process monitoring where OT systems provide process control data (Cpk analyses, SPC implementations).
- Manage vendor relationships for control system components, PLC/HMI platforms, and system integrators; review and accept vendor deliverables.
- Participate in continuous improvement projects to increase automation reliability, reduce downtime, and support scalability.
